WebFrom my experiences of military personnel and police officers in the UK, both of whom use the word ma'am to address female, superior officers; I can tell you that it is commonly pronounced as "marm" (with the letter r, being a non-rhotic one). This has been the case for several decades, at least. Share Improve this answer Follow WebIn the past, gender pronouns were separated into masculine ( he/him/his) and feminine ( she/her/hers ).
